COVID-19 patient in Abu Dhabi airlifted between hospitals

Abu Dhabi Police

A 60-year-old COVID-19 patient was airlifted from one hospital to another in Abu Dhabi to receive urgent care to treat COVID-19.

The air ambulance of the Abu Dhabi Police Aviation Department in the Operations Sector helped transport the patient from Madinat Zayed Hospital to Sheikh Khalifa Medical City Hospital after being alerted about his critical condition.

The authority said the patient was provided with all necessary medical care during the flight to the hospital.
